引言随着前端技术的发展,Vue3作为Vue.js框架的最新版本,已经成为了现代前端开发的主流选择。高效开发Vue3项目,不仅需要掌握其核心特性和API,还需要遵循一定的代码风格与规范,以确保代码的可读...
随着前端技术的发展,Vue3作为Vue.js框架的最新版本,已经成为了现代前端开发的主流选择。高效开发Vue3项目,不仅需要掌握其核心特性和API,还需要遵循一定的代码风格与规范,以确保代码的可读性、可维护性和团队协作效率。本文将深入探讨Vue3的代码风格与规范,帮助开发者提升开发效率。
为了确保代码风格的一致性,推荐使用Prettier和ESLint等工具。
MyComponent。myVariable和myMethod。MY_CONSTANT。将不同功能模块的代码分门别类,便于管理和维护。
使用模板语法清晰地描述视图和数据的绑定关系。
数据变化时,视图会自动更新。
通过v-model指令实现数据和视图的双向绑定。
使用混入实现代码的复用。
使用插槽实现组件的组合。
使用指令扩展Vue实例的指令集。
组件名应为多个单词组成,且命名规范为kebab-case格式,如my-component。
为每个组件编写详细的使用文档,方便他人使用。
遵循Vue3的代码风格与规范,有助于提升开发效率,降低维护成本。在实际开发过程中,应根据项目需求和团队习惯进行调整。通过不断学习和实践,相信每位开发者都能掌握Vue3高效开发之道。